Paul Holser is a Senior AI/OR Engineer with 15+ years of experience building high-quality, maintainable software across domains like retail, finance, and telecom. He pairs a Master’s in Operations Research with deep hands-on expertise in Java, Ruby, Python, and C# to deliver optimization-driven solutions and rapid feedback loops for multidisciplinary teams. A longtime advocate of test-driven development, he has contributed notable property-based testing enhancements to the junit-quickcheck project, expanding generators and exhaustive execution modes. His career spans startups and enterprises where he mentors teams, champions executable specifications, and designs resilient services from POS systems to AI/OR pipelines. Colleagues rely on him for pragmatic architecture and developer ergonomics that reduce long-term maintenance costs. Outside product work, he’s comfortable shifting languages and tools to fit the problem, preferring the best tool for the task.

pholser/junit-quickcheck

Oct 2010 - Apr 2022

Property-based testing, JUnit-style
Role in this project:
userBack-end Developer & Test Automation Engineer
Contributions:61 reviews, 1138 commits, 337 PRs in 11 years 7 months
Contributions summary:Paul's commits focus on implementing property-based testing features within the JUnit Quickcheck library. They added extractors for BigInteger and BigDecimal, and expanded support for various types in tests. Further contributions included adding support for generic types and handling ranges in generators, and incorporating features to the testing framework by introducing exhaustive execution mode and adding various utility functions to the framework.
